These were caused by artillery bombardments, extensive aerial bombing of North and South Vietnam, the use of firepower in military operations conducted in heavily populated areas, assassinations, massacres, and terror tactics. The war also spilled over into the neighboring countries of Cambodia and Laos which also endured casualties from aerial bombing and ground fighting.Ĭivilian deaths caused by both sides amounted to a significant percentage of total deaths. The war lasted from 1955 to 1975 and most of the fighting took place in South Vietnam accordingly it suffered the most casualties. Estimates can include both civilian and military deaths in North and South Vietnam, Laos, and Cambodia.
